Solution for 3(x-5)=2x-5 equation:


Simplifying
3(x + -5) = 2x + -5

Reorder the terms:
3(-5 + x) = 2x + -5
(-5 * 3 + x * 3) = 2x + -5
(-15 + 3x) = 2x + -5

Reorder the terms:
-15 + 3x = -5 + 2x

Solving
-15 + 3x = -5 + 2x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-2x' to each side of the equation.
-15 + 3x + -2x = -5 + 2x + -2x

Combine like terms: 3x + -2x = 1x
-15 + 1x = -5 + 2x + -2x

Combine like terms: 2x + -2x = 0
-15 + 1x = -5 + 0
-15 + 1x = -5

Add '15' to each side of the equation.
-15 + 15 + 1x = -5 + 15

Combine like terms: -15 + 15 = 0
0 + 1x = -5 + 15
1x = -5 + 15

Combine like terms: -5 + 15 = 10
1x = 10

Divide each side by '1'.
x = 10

Simplifying
x = 10
